- go to http://www.polleverywhere.com/ to sign up to your free account (polling under 30 people)
- opening page provides information on who and why people use polleverywhere
- once you have signed up for your free account you can start creating your polls
- put in information, then customise your graph/chart

Lesson Plan:Introduction:
As students will be learning different persuasive devices that they will use to annotate feature articles. The way the students will be learning different persuasive devices and revising them will be through interactive quizzes using Polleverywhere. Instead of using traditional written multiple choice questions on printed paper, students can see real time polling in the classroom anonymously.
10min
Body:
- Teacher explain Polleverywhere activity to students and the importance of revising persuasive devices and being able to recognise examples
- set students up with their mobiles to they are compatible and go through polling instructions with students
- present the online polling questions to students, where students will answer what they believe is the correct response to the example- this is an anonymous process and information is updated in real time; shown in a graph
- after polling each example teacher and students are involved in discussion about the selected device eg: why was it the correct answer? why not?
- students will then fill out information regarding persuasive device the definition (written on board collaboratively) and the example given; students will also have to create their own definition
50min
Conclusion:
after students have completed work in their book teacher ill go around and mark books off with satisfactory/ not satisfactory, ensuring students have completed work. students will be assessed on their involvement in class discussion and interactive polling. Pack up classroom
10min
